Discrimination at work is illegal in Germany. And the deadline is short. The German General Equal Treatment Act (AGG) protects you against discrimination based on ethnic origin, gender, religion or belief, disability, age, or sexual identity — in hiring, promotion, pay, and dismissal. Harassment, including sexual harassment and systematic bullying („Mobbing“), falls under the same protection.
The critical deadline
Compensation claims under the AGG must be asserted in writing within two months of the discriminatory act. This is one of the shortest deadlines in German employment law — internationals lose valid claims to it every week.
What you can claim
Damages for material loss and compensation for the discrimination itself; in dismissal cases, discrimination arguments can also strengthen your settlement position considerably.
